Nurturing Friendships in a High-Stakes Corporate World

Are you struggling to maintain friendships while carrying a demanding career? Want to foster intentional connection without feeling depleted? Today on the Legal Yogi Podcast, host Vanisha Weatherspoon dives into practical strategies for nurturing authentic relationships despite the emotionally and mentally exhausting demands of high-stakes professions like law, healthcare, or education. Learn how to combat guilt and isolation by embracing sustainable self-awareness and setting boundaries that honor your energy levels.

KEY TAKEAWAYS:

  • Prioritize sustainable friendships by embracing self-awareness and setting boundaries to manage your energy in a demanding career, reducing guilt and isolation while fostering authentic connections.
  • Use asynchronous communication, like voice notes, to maintain intentional connection without the mentally and emotionally exhausting pressure of real-time interaction in high-stakes professions.
  • Celebrate small wins and share thoughtful gestures to deepen friendship, ensuring authentic relationships thrive despite the depleting demands of Legal Yogi work and life.

ABOUT THE HOST:

Vanisha is a 500-hour Registered Yoga Teacher (RYT) and resides in Austin, TX. She began her yoga journey in 2017 during her 1L year at Georgetown Law. The first year of law school is often the most challenging and can be a gateway to the bad habits that are prevalent among legal professionals. Lawyers are at an extremely high risk of alcoholism, drug abuse and dependency, anxiety and depression, so Vanisha turned to yoga to avoid falling victim to one of the former. It was here on her mat that she found peace, which led her to want to bring this to her law school community. Vanisha became a certified instructor during the summer of her 2L year of law school and began teaching classes on Georgetown’s campus in the fall of her 3L year. Upon graduation, she obtained her 300-hour certification in 2020 and returned to Austin, where she teaches yoga and practices law as a fifth-year associate at a law firm.
